Write a short summary of what happens in the film
We open with dramatic shots of objects that have been abandoned. They appear one after the other, covered in cobwebs and dust. Then we realize that these objects are all hobby items like a surf board, big bike, and the like. Then we hear the verses of the 80’s song “Reunited:
“I was a fool to ever leave your side.
Me minus was such a lonely ride.
The break up we had has made me lonesome and sad.
I realized I love you ‘cause I want you bad. Hey, hey!”
At this point, we see the owners joyfully reuniting with their objects of passion as we hear the chorus:
“Reunited and it feels so good. Reunited ‘cause we understood”
The song continues as we see more “reunions” culminating with our message and a call to action in supers: “Never part with your passions again. Become a Philam Life Financial Coach.”
Please tell us about the social behaviour and/or cultural insights that inspired your campaign
Being the social media capital of the world, it’s easy to find evidence on how much Fillennials (Filipino Millennials) aspire to live a hashtag-worthy lifestyle. They actively talk about how they want to focus on their hobbies and on gaining more experiences.
This is why this generation veers away from the traditional 9-5 jobs. They crave for more control over their own time so that they can freely pursue their interests. However, they are also realistic and practical. They are aware of the reality of life here in the Philippines and they know that they cannot sustain this lifestyle without a stable career.
